Sony had been hoping for the beta of Killzone 2 to make it out this year, but an SCEA rep has now said that they don’t believe they’ll have anything ready before the end of the year. That’s good if you ask me, because what gamer really has time to play ANOTHER game right now?
“We are hoping to do a beta but I don’t think we’ll have anything ready before this year is over… it is something we are working on for next year,” a spokesperson told PSU.
Developer Guerilla announced that a public multiplayer beta was in the works, but there was never any timeframe given for its release. The game is still set to release some in mid to late 2008, so a beta in the spring seems very possible. Given the success that the Halo 3 beta had and its proximity to the release of the game, the beta not being ready doesn’t necessarily have any bearing on the release of the game itself.
